The MBP is all around a much better notebook, and comes with a real video card - 128MB Nvidia 8600M GT. If you have a copy of Windows, use boot camp to dual boot and it becomes a very capable gaming notebook. It weighs only 0.2lb more than the Macbook despite the much larger screen.

Definitely not worth it for the ram upgrade (it usually never is from the OEM). The Macbooks use the same DDR2-667 sodimms as everyone else, you could pick up 2x1GB sticks for under $80CDN (link)
